Former optometrist Sanjit Singh Bansal who was struck off in February 2008 (News 15.02.08) for selling his employer's property on eBay has been sentenced to another 200 hours' community service for a similar offence at a different practice by Sevenoaks Magistrates' Court.
Bansal, who stole £1,500 worth of equipment and sunglasses from Niall O'Kane Optometrists in Strood, Kent where he had worked for 10 years, pleaded guilty to the first offence at Maidstone Crown Court in September 2006, claiming he had an eBay addiction. Having been struck off by the General Optical Council for 'a clear and flagrant breach of trust and theft from an employer', his counsel said that Bansal had addressed his eBay addiction.
